How much do security risk assessment j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for security risk assessment in California is $49.75,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$40.34 and $59.33 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Security Risk Assessment job?

A Security Risk Assessment job involves identifying, analyzing, and mitigating potential security threats to an organization's systems, data, and operations. Professionals in this role evaluate vulnerabilities, assess risks, and recommend security controls to protect against cyber threats, fraud, and compliance issues. They work with IT teams, management, and stakeholders to ensure security measures align with business objectives and regulatory requirements. This job often requires knowledge of cybersecurity frameworks, risk management methodologies, and relevant industry standards.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Security Risk Assessment position, and why are they important?

To thrive in Security Risk Assessment, a strong background in risk analysis, information security principles, and regulatory compliance is essential, often supported by a degree in cybersecurity or related fields. Familiarity with risk assessment tools, frameworks like NIST or ISO 27001, and certifications such as CISSP or CISA are highly valued. Exceptional attention to detail, analytical thinking, and effective communication skills set top professionals apart in this role. These competencies enable accurate identification of potential security threats and development of strategic mitigation plans, which are crucial for safeguarding organizational assets.

What are some common challenges faced in a Security Risk Assessment role?

Professionals in Security Risk Assessment often face the challenge of keeping up with constantly evolving cyber threats and adapting assessment methodologies accordingly. Balancing thorough analysis with the need to provide timely recommendations can be demanding, especially when collaborating with multiple departments or stakeholders. Additionally, communicating complex risk findings to non-technical audiences requires both clarity and diplomacy. Overcoming these challenges is critical for delivering actionable insights that drive effective security decision-making and protect organizational assets.

Job description

NAVA Software solutions is looking for a Security Risk Manager
Details:
Security Risk Manager
Duration: 10 months
Location: San Francisco CA(Hybrid)
IMPORTANT:
  • Specifically, the company wants someone with adept experience in security risk management (not just third-party risk management or compliance or vulnerability management).
  • Consulting with Big 4
  • Security Risk management / Cybersecurity risk management experience for 5+ years
Responsibilities:
Risk Management
  • Identify, assess, monitor, and report risks with minimal supervision
  • Complete targeted risk assessments based on company framework as well as industry requirements
  • Operationalize SLAs for risk management
  • Support and enhance the risk reporting metrics
  • Integrate Risk program across the company processes and effectively measures effectiveness of the integrations
  • Support documentation, review, and enhancement of the risk management standard, methodologies, policy or operating procedures
  • Provide subject matter expertise on risks tracked by risk management
  • Evaluates mitigation efforts including the design and effectiveness of operational controls, based on industry best practice models in accordance w/ risk and compliance requirements.
  • Engage with your stakeholders to identify issues, understand their needs and challenges to proactively find ways that your program can support
